Transaction 41ba6fee39042e8de4bf7127d7271d60fb8aa25e4ddf3fa997393e72637c5ca5

1 Input
1 Outputs
  • 41ba6fee39042e8de4bf7127d7271d60fb8aa25e4ddf3fa997393e72637c5ca5:0
  • value  2145228
    address  3C1S4MY1kReHaXWEYGDxjt6ZEvvf6JizpH